What Are The 3 Steps Of Nuclear Fusion?

What Are The 3 Steps Of Nuclear Fusion? Two protons within the Sun fuse. … A third proton collides with the formed deuterium. … Two helium-3 nuclei collide, creating a helium-4 nucleus plus two extra protons that escape as two hydrogen.
